  • Announcement (January 16) - Folio Producer tools update

    Digital Publishing Suite will be releasing new features and functionality Monday January 16 at 5:00 PM Pacific Coast time and Tuesday January 17 at noon. While the acrobat.com server is being updated, you may not be able to use the Folio Producer tools. New features include embedded overlays in slideshows, enhanced buttons that support sound/video actions, article relink, PDF pinch and zoom with all overlays, custom-created Adobe Content Viewer, and more. I'll post a more complete list after the update, or you can look at What's new in this release when help is updated.
    Again, note that there are two separate installers: one for the Folio Producer tools and one for the Folio Builder panel. If you created a custom viewer using a previous set of tools and don't want to update your viewer app, install only the Folio Builder panel to stay in sync with the updated web client. If you want to update all your tools, install the Folio Producer tools first, and then install the Folio Builder panel. For this release, updating the Folio Builder panel is recommended but not required. See Installing digital publishing tools.
    The v18 file format is a change from the previous file format, so any folio you create with the newest set of tools will not work with the current Adobe Content Viewer (2.2) or with custom viewer apps. Trying to open a folio results in a "Please update your app" message. However, if you have a Professional or Enterprise account, you can use the Viewer Builder to create a custom version of the Adobe Content Viewer so that you don't have to wait for Apple to approve. If you do not have a Pro or Enterprise account, you may want to wait until Apple approves the new viewer before you update your Folio Producer tools.

  • Update to Folio Producer Tools (Oct. 3)

    Digital Publishing Suite will be releasing new features and functionality Monday Oct 3rd at 5:00 PM Pacific Coast time. There are now two separate installers: one for the Folio Producer tools and one for the Folio Builder panel. If you created a custom viewer using a previous set of tools and don't want to update the viewer app, install only the Folio Builder panel to stay in sync with the updated web client. If you want to update all your tools, install the Folio Producer tools first, and then install the Folio Builder panel. SeeInstalling digital publishing tools.
    The v16 file format is identical to the previous file format, so any folio you create with the newest set of tools works with the current Adobe Content Viewer (1.9). Adobe submitted a new version of the app to Apple. When the new viewer is available, Preview on Device will work for the iPad (Mac only; third-party utility required).   • UPDATE: Folio Producer tools 1.1.0

    (June 14) The new version of the Folio Producer tools (Drop 13) is now available to install. However, before you install the new tools, note the following:
    * The Adobe Content Viewer for the iPad that works with these tools is not yet available in the Apple Store. You cannot use the current viewer to preview folios created with the new version of the tools. The Adobe Content Viewer for the Android and for the Desktop are both currently available.
    * Any folio you publish using the new set of tools is incompatible with a custom viewer app created with a previous set of tools. If you publish folios using the new tools, update your custom viewer app in the store.
    Some customers have reported problems in uploading articles to acrobat.com. If you experience problems with uploading articles or downloading folios to a mobile device, please let us know through the forum so that the product team can address the issue.
